I did the first workout (HGI), and also the premix with weights only.

You have to be quick with this one, moving from cardio machine to weights. Not much time between. It helps if you can preview, just so you know what's coming up. Or, previewing the premix with dumbbells only.

I liked Home Gym Interval very much. Kelly's speed on the TM is 6.0, once she's spent some time warming up.

Again, it moves fast. Like she says, be familiar with your machines so you can pause, and jump right back on when you're done lifting. Sam waits for her machine to slow down first before moving to the other exercises, which is a safety precaution.

At first I was hitting the stop button on my TM, and which would take me a while to get back up to speed when I'd hit the start button again. Then, I started hitting my pause button instead. You all will get the hang of it once you do the workout a couple times.

And, it's fun! A new way to workout. Plus, some of the moves are kettlebell reminiscent. Hot potato.
